Carpenters Salary in Minneapolis-St Paul-Bloomington, Wisconsin

The annual salary statistics of carpenters in Minneapolis-St Paul-Bloomington, Wisconsin is shown in Table 1. The wage data of carpenters in Minneapolis-St Paul-Bloomington is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of Carpenters in Minneapolis-St Paul-Bloomington, Wisconsin

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$42,990
25th Percentile Wage
$48,330
50th Percentile Wage
$61,420
75th Percentile Wage
$79,470
90th Percentile Wage
$87,000

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for carpenters in Minneapolis-St Paul-Bloomington, Wisconsin in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$87,000.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$61,420.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$42,990.

Table 2. Compare Carpenters Salary in Minneapolis-St Paul-Bloomington with Other Wisconsin Cities

From Table 3 we note that with a median annual salary of $61,420, Minneapolis-St Paul-Bloomington is the second highest paying city for carpenters in state of Wisconsin, following the highest paying city Oshkosh-Neenah (median annual salary of $63,640). Compared with Oshkosh-Neenah, the median annual salary of carpenters in Minneapolis-St Paul-Bloomington is 3.5 percent (3.5%) lower.

Cities/Areas Median Annual Salary
Oshkosh-Neenah
$63,640
Minneapolis-St Paul-Bloomington
$61,420
Lake County-Kenosha County
$60,840
Appleton
$56,400
Green Bay
$53,750
Milwaukee-Waukesha-West Allis
$52,950
Madison
$52,120
Fond du Lac
$52,080
Duluth
$52,000
La Crosse
$52,000
Janesville
$51,380
Eastern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area
$49,710
Sheboygan
$49,590
Eau Claire
$49,500
Wausau
$48,170
Racine
$47,960
South Central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area
$47,790
West Central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area
$47,610
Southwestern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area
$46,790
Northern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area
$36,410
